Shipping perishable goods internationally — fresh produce, cut flowers, seafood, dairy, and similar time- and temperature-sensitive products — requires planning around a hard constraint that most cargo doesn't have: a genuinely limited shelf life that keeps ticking regardless of documentation delays, customs queues, or carrier scheduling.
Speed and reliability of transit matter more than absolute cost minimization for most perishable shipments, which is why air freight remains the dominant mode for genuinely perishable goods over any meaningful distance, despite its higher cost relative to ocean freight. The math is straightforward: a lower freight rate doesn't help if the product arrives unsellable.
Pre-cooling before transport is critical and often overlooked by shippers newer to perishables. Loading warm product into a refrigerated container or aircraft compartment forces the cooling system to work far harder to bring temperature down during transit, rather than simply maintaining an already-cool product — and that lag can cost meaningful shelf life before the journey has even really started. Product should generally be brought to its target temperature before it's loaded, not after.
Packaging for perishables has to balance protection with airflow — many fresh products, particularly produce, continue to respire (consume oxygen, release carbon dioxide and heat) after harvest, and packaging that's too tightly sealed can trap that heat and accelerate spoilage rather than prevent it. Ventilated packaging designed for the specific product category is usually a better choice than simply using the most protective packaging available.
Customs clearance speed is disproportionately important for perishables compared to other cargo, since a delay that would be a minor inconvenience for durable goods can mean a shipment arrives with significantly reduced remaining shelf life, or in the worst case, no commercial value left at all. Having all documentation — phytosanitary certificates, health certificates, and any product-specific import permits — fully prepared and verified before the shipment departs is essential, since perishables generally can't absorb the delay of fixing paperwork issues after arrival.
Working with a forwarder who has specific, demonstrated experience in your product category matters more for perishables than for most other cargo types, since the operational details — pre-cooling coordination, cold chain continuity, prioritized customs handling — require genuine specialization, not just general freight forwarding capability. Ask specifically about their track record with your product type and be wary of forwarders who treat a perishable shipment the same as any standard cargo booking.
Humidity control is as important as temperature for many perishable categories, and it's a dimension that's easy to overlook when focused primarily on the temperature reading. Cut flowers, for example, are highly sensitive to both temperature and relative humidity — too dry, and stems lose water and wilt prematurely; too humid in combination with certain temperature ranges, and condensation can encourage fungal growth and botrytis damage that ruins the product's appearance well before any temperature-related spoilage would occur. Fresh produce has similarly specific humidity requirements that vary by product, and a cold chain solution optimized purely for temperature without corresponding humidity control can still result in a shipment that arrives visibly degraded despite the temperature log showing everything stayed within range.
For businesses shipping perishables regularly by air, it's worth knowing that some airlines and forwarders hold specific perishables-handling certifications — such as IATA's CEIV Fresh certification — that indicate a demonstrated, audited standard of perishables handling capability across their facilities and processes, rather than just a general claim of experience. While certification alone doesn't guarantee a perfect outcome on every shipment, it's a meaningful signal when comparing forwarders for a perishables-heavy shipping program, and it's a reasonable, specific question to ask during forwarder selection rather than relying on general reassurances about cold chain capability.
Harvest and production timing should be coordinated with your logistics booking rather than treated as entirely separate decisions, particularly for agricultural perishables where the product's remaining shelf life at the moment of harvest directly determines how much buffer you have for the shipping journey ahead. Booking transport capacity in advance of harvest, based on a realistic harvest date estimate, and building in contingency for the inevitable timing shifts that agricultural production involves, reduces the risk of a shipment being rushed to meet a booking that was set without enough coordination with actual production timing.
For businesses new to exporting perishables, it's worth starting with a shorter, more well-established trade lane before attempting a longer or less familiar route, simply to build operational experience with the full chain — pre-cooling, packaging, documentation, and customs — under conditions with more margin for error. A route with a shorter transit time gives you more room to learn from early mistakes without the product's shelf life being consumed entirely by a lengthy journey, and the operational lessons learned on that shorter route translate directly to managing the tighter margins a longer, more ambitious route will eventually require.
